Приймач даних по лазерному каналу зв’язку з криптографічним захистом
Автор: Timur Biriukov • Май 28, 2020 • Курсовая работа • 2,742 Слов (11 Страниц) • 369 Просмотры
Факультет радіофізики, електроніки та комп’ютерних систем
Кафедра радіотехніки та радіоелектронних систем
КУРСОВИЙ ПРОЕКТ
з конструювання та розробки пристроїв телекомунікаційних мереж
Приймач даних по лазерному каналу зв’язку з криптографічним захистом
Виконавець:
студент 3 курсу
(спеціальність “Телекомунікації та радіотехніка”)
Єршиков Максим Едуардович
Науковий керівник:
асистент кафедри
радіотехніки та радіоелектронних систем
Фесенко Сергій Олександрович
Київ-2019
ЗМІСТ
ВСТУП ................................................................................................................ 3
РОЗДІЛ 1. АНАЛІЗ СПОСОБІВ ПЕРЕДАЧІ ІНФОРМАЦІЇ .................…... 4
1.1. Класифікація телекомунікаційних систем за середовищем розповсюдження сигналу …...………………………………………...….…... 4
1.2. Характеристика оптичного середовища передачі …......................... 5
РОЗДІЛ 2. АНАЛІЗ ІСНУЮЧИХ КРИПТОГРАФІЧНИХ АЛГОРИТМІВ ………………………………………………………………………………… 7
2.1. Розгляд основних алгоритмів шифрування ………..…..………..... 7
2.1.1. Алгоритм RSA ………………………..……………………..…... 9
2.1.2. Алгоритм DES …...……………………………………….……. 10
2.1.3. Алгоритм AES ………………………………………………..... 13
2.1.4. Шифр Вернама ………………………………...……………...... 16
2.2. Вибір криптографічного алгоритму ...……...……………………... 17
РОЗДІЛ 3. РОЗРОБКА СХЕМИ ПРИЙМАЧА ПО ЛАЗЕРНОМУ КАНАЛУ ЗВ’ЯЗКУ ……………...……………………………..………………...…..…. 18
3.1. Проектування електричної принципової схеми …..….....…..……. 18
3.2. Розведення плати та її виготовлення ..……...…………………..…. 19
РОЗДІЛ 4. ПРОГРАМУВАННЯ МІКРОКОНТРОЛЕРА
ТА ДОСЛІДЖЕННЯ ЙОГО РОБОТИ ...………...……………………….... 21
4.1. Ініціалізація портів вводу та виводу ………………………………. 21
4.2. Прослуховування порту вводу ………….……………………...….. 21
4.3. Читання, обробка та вивід сигналу ………………………………... 22
4.4. Прошивка мікроконтролера та аналіз його роботи ...…………….. 23
ВИСНОВКИ ...……………………………………………….…………......... 25
СПИСОК ВИКОРИСТАННИХ ДЖЕРЕЛ ...…………………….…………. 26
ДОДАТОК А. ВИХІДНИЙ КОД ПРОГРАМИ МІКРОКОНТРОЛЕРА …. 27
ВСТУП
Сучасний світ важно уявити без комп’ютерів, а саме без мікроконтролерів. Вони використовується для керування різноманітними електронними пристроями. Використання однієї мікросхеми значно знижує розміри, енергоспоживання і вартість пристроїв, побудованих на базі мікроконтролерів.
Мікроконтролери можна зустріти в багатьох сучасних приладах, таких як телефони, пральні машини, вони відповідають за роботу двигунів і систем гальмування сучасних автомобілів, з їх допомогою створюються системи контролю і системи збору інформації. Вони інтегруються в такі сфери життя, де звичайна людина може навіть не знати про їх існування. Наприклад, у різні системи “розумного” будинку.
Стрімке підвищення обчислювальних потужностей сучасних комп'ютерних систем та розвиток інформаційних технологій підняли проблему захисту інформації від несанкціонованого доступу. Тому особливу увагу має захист інформації криптографічними алгоритмами.
...